In this age of accounting scandals and corporate wrongdoing, progressive organizations are seeking ways to foster a more ethical corporate culture. This DVD profiles Lockheed Martin, Inc. and explores their work in promoting ethics in the workplace.

The Red Wing Manufacturers Association, Red Wing Chamber of Commerce, Hiawatha Valley – Society for Human Resources Management and Southeast Technical College are partnering to present a Healthcare Reform Panel. Our goal is to help business people in our community “Cut through the Confusion.”
